The Selah House
The Selah House, located at 603 East Main Street in Ottawa, Illinois, offers a historic and cozy lodging experience just 10 miles from Starved Rock. Perfect for families, big groups, reunions, or corporate seminars, this 5600 sq. ft. space is ideal for those looking for a comfortable and spacious accommodation. Guests will enjoy the convenient location near family-friendly activities, restaurants, and nightlife. Off-street parking and two garage spaces are available for guests. Please note that pets are not allowed. Additionally, there is a 5% Hotel/Motel Tax that goes to the City of Ottawa added to the cost.
